在Angular中,*ngIf是一个指令,不能直接在其中使用JavaScript的indexOf方法。相反,你可以在组件中创建一个方法,并将其用作*ngIf的条...
要测试一个间隔内的操作,你可以使用Jasmine的fakeAsync和tick函数来模拟时间的流逝。下面是一个示例代码:import { TestBed, fa...
可以使用Angular的Array的filter方法来获取包含在对象数组中的对象数组的匹配元素的值。下面是一个示例代码:首先,我们假设有一个包含对象数组的变量d...
在Angular中,你可以使用Observables和RxJS库来处理异步调用和后端过程。以下是一个示例,演示了如何在异步调用后调用后端过程:首先,确保你的An...
在Angular中,如果HTTP响应未定义,可能有几个原因。以下是一些可能的解决方法:确保正确导入所需的模块和服务:确保已正确导入HttpClientModul...
要解决“Angular - 函数 Observable 的问题”,您可以遵循以下步骤:导入所需的库和模块:import { Observable } from ...
在Angular中,组件的销毁是在它的生命周期函数ngOnDestroy中进行的。当组件被销毁时,你可以在ngOnDestroy中进行一些清理工作,比如取消订阅...
如果Angular的Http Interceptor没有触发,请尝试以下解决方法:确保在应用的根模块(通常是app.module.ts)中正确地导入和提供Htt...
在Angular中,Host Listener是一个装饰器,用于在宿主元素上监听事件。UnloadNotification是一个事件,当用户离开页面或关闭浏览器...
在Angular和Ionic中进行HTTPS请求的步骤如下:首先,确保你的Ionic项目已经安装了@angular/common/http模块,可以通过以下命令...
在Angular中,当页面加载包含混合内容(如HTTP和HTTPS混合)时,会出现“混合内容:页面在'https错误'”错误。要解决此问题,你可以使用以下方法之...
在Angular中,可以使用forkJoin操作符来获取来自多个请求的响应。forkJoin操作符将多个Observables作为参数,并发地订阅它们,并等待所...
要获取当前激活的路由并重新导航到具有不同路由参数的同一页面,可以使用Angular的路由服务和路由器。首先,在组件中注入ActivatedRoute和Route...
当在Angular中绑定一个对象时,如果直接在HTML中使用插值表达式将对象显示出来,将会显示为[Object Object]。为了正确地显示对象的值,你可以使...
在Angular中,组件的生命周期函数ngOnInit是在组件初始化完成后被调用的。如果在ngOnInit中调用了异步函数,可能会导致Highcharts无法正...
以下是一个使用Angular的示例代码,用于滚动到元素底部:在组件的HTML模板中,给要滚动到的元素添加一个标识符,比如添加一个id属性:
要在Angular中使用Google Analytics自定义事件,你可以按照以下步骤进行操作:首先,确保你已经在你的Angular项目中安装了Google A...
要解决Angular中工具栏被抽屉遮挡的问题,您可以使用Flex布局来调整组件的显示位置。以下是一种可能的解决方案:在HTML模板中,将工具栏和抽屉放在同一个父...
在Angular中,可以通过使用ActivatedRoute和Title服务来根据路由和组件数据设置页面标题。以下是一个代码示例:首先,需要在组件中引入Acti...
在Angular中,可以使用HttpClient来发送HTTP请求,并通过设置responseType参数为blob来获取文件的二进制数据。然后,可以使用URL...